Requirements Must have:
- We require at least 6 years of experience working on projects that implement solutions across the software development lifecycle.
- We require at least 4 years in a technical leadership role, with or without direct reports.
- We require a bachelors degree in Computer Science, CIS, or a related field, along with at least 10 years of experience in software development or a related discipline; equivalent work experience may substitute for the degree.
- We prefer 4 years of development experience with Node.js.
- We prefer 4 years of development experience with Oracle.
- We look for strong expertise in enterprise application architecture, solution design, and technical governance.
- We value experience with Dev Ops, Agile, and Waterfall delivery practices.
- We expect familiarity with cloud-based, secure, high-volume, high-transaction systems and integration environments.
- We lead enterprise CMS strategy and guide the evolution of Adobe Experience Manager within complex enterprise environments.
- We provide architectural leadership and advisory support for scalable, secure, high-performing digital solutions.
- We partner with application, product, architecture, engineering, security, infrastructure, and delivery teams to align technical direction with enterprise goals.
- We translate business strategy and requirements into actionable technical designs, stable systems, and maintainable solution architectures.
- We oversee solution reviews, implementation guidance, and governance to ensure adherence to architectural standards and best practices.
- We manage platform reliability through continuous improvement efforts, incident response, and root cause analysis.
- We define and maintain standards, reference architectures, and governance processes that inform design and investment decisions.
- We oversee CDN and NGINX configurations and related automation to support secure and efficient operations.
- We provide technical direction for data management, database technology, interfaces, coding, testing, and release readiness.
- We mentor and coach team members, foster collaboration, and help resolve complex technical issues across multiple work streams.
- We build and sustain relationships with internal stakeholders, vendors, and senior leaders to secure alignment and support.
- We keep our technical knowledge current by tracking industry trends, engaging with experts, and sharing recommendations across the organization.
We are Kaiser Permanente, and this role is based in Greensboro, North Carolina with a flexible hybrid arrangement that combines on-site work at a KP location with work from home. This is a full-time, regular, individual contributor position on our IT Engineering team, with a day shift schedule Monday through Friday and no travel required. We offer a competitive total rewards package with a posted pay range of $147,900 to $191,400 per year, along with benefits including 401(k), dental, employee assistance, flexible spending, health and vision insurance, health savings, life insurance, paid time off, parental leave, and a retirement plan.
We are committed to pay equity and transparency, and actual pay is determined by market data, internal alignment, and relevant experience, education, certifications, skills, and location.
